Majestic Royal Heritage

Step into the heart of London’s regal history, where centuries of monarchy come alive amid grand palaces and iconic ceremonial traditions. The city pulses with timeless charm today as you wander through the vast lawns, ornate interiors, and storied halls of Westminster’s Royal landmarks, immersing deeply in the stories of kings and queens, grand celebrations, and the invisible threads linking past to present. The sunlight bounces gently on historic facades as London embraces the warmth of August, inviting you into an elegant immersion of culture and royal spectacle.

Begin your regal cultural journey early at , where the serenity of the soaring Gothic architecture envelopes you. As you cross thresholds once graced by monarchs and poets, listen closely to the whispering histories embedded in the stone—this is where kings and queens were crowned, united, and remembered. Be sure to admire the intricate stained glass windows diffusing morning light and the Poet's Corner, which holds memorials to Britain's literary giants. After a mindful exploration, step outside to the vibrant atmosphere of Parliament Square with the iconic Big Ben chiming nearby, grounding you in London’s civic heart just before a gentle stroll heads you onward.

Next, saunter towards , the resplendent centerpiece of Britain's monarchy nestled beside St. James’s Park. Arriving in time for the famed Changing of the Guard, watch the precise, colorful procession unfold—a symbol of tradition, ceremony, and British pomp. The disciplined movements and elegant red tunics set against the palace’s grand backdrop create a moment of shared cultural pride. Post-ceremony, relax with a meander through ’s emerald expanses, where the lake offers a haven of calm shaded by ancient trees, and floral displays brighten the warm August afternoon, a perfect retreat for couples savoring a quiet moment in London's royal gardens.

The afternoon beckons with a short journey by the iconic London Underground from to Tower Hill, leading you to the formidable . Here, the past feels palpably alive from the moment you pass through the medieval portcullis. Engage in a colorful, lively Yeoman Warder tour that breathes life into tales of intrigue, imprisonment, and royal spectacle. Explore the dazzling Crown Jewels—perhaps the world’s most extraordinary collection of royal regalia—sparkling under soft lighting in the White Tower. As the summer sun dips lower, wander along the towers and ramparts, touching centuries-old stones that witnessed everything from royal victories to dark betrayals, completing your day soaked in the grandeur and drama of London’s royal narrative.

Artistic Treasures & Literary London

Dive into a day rich with cultural wonders as London’s vibrant art scene and literary heritage unfold around every corner. From world-renowned museums housing masterpieces across centuries to intimate bookshops and evocative theatres, this day paints a vivid portrait of the city’s creative soul. The glowing August skies illuminate vast galleries and secret cultural nooks, inviting an intimate conversation with London’s artistic legacy that leaves you inspired and connected.

Start your day at the , where you can immerse yourself in humanity’s vast cultural heritage in one of the most impressive collections anywhere on Earth. Wander through expansive galleries filled with artifacts from ancient civilizations, from the striking Egyptian mummies to the artistry of the Parthenon marbles. The museum’s grand Great Court, illuminated by its glass roof, offers a moment of calm reflection and natural light that perfectly complements the sensational exhibits. Take your time absorbing the stories embedded in each exhibit, especially August’s pleasant warmth making the interior refuge from outdoor bustle. The experience sparks wonder and appreciation for global cultures and histories that intertwine deeply with London’s own story.

A scenic walk leads you to Trafalgar Square and the venerable , where you encounter masterpieces that have shaped Western art history. As you meander through rooms adorned with works by Turner, Botticelli, and Vermeer, allow yourself to pause and engage with the emotional depth and technical brilliance of each canvas. August’s longer daylight makes it a joy to stroll outside through the square’s lively atmosphere after absorbing the tranquility and contemplation inside. The ’s central location offers a vibrant slice of London life with street performers and local artists adding charm to the scene.

From the buzz of Trafalgar Square, wander over to the legendary Charing Cross Road, a paradise for lovers of books. The mix of quaint secondhand bookshops and specialist stores invites leisurely browsing and discovering literary treasures, from rare editions to contemporary gems. Take note of the cozy atmosphere and exchange knowledge with friendly shop owners who often share anecdotes and recommendations. This treasure hunt deepens your connection with London's literary fabric, a unique personal adventure in a city famed for its storytellers.

Conclude your cultural day with a visit to Shakespeare’s Globe Theatre on the southern bank of the Thames. Whether you join a guided tour or catch a live performance, this intimate Elizabethan recreates the vibrant theatrical culture of Shakespeare’s time with authenticity and passion. The open-air setting is especially magical in the mild August evenings, heightening the experience as you and your partner share laughter, suspense, and charm under the open sky where literary history truly comes alive.

Thames Serenity & Cultural Nights

Conclude your London adventure embracing the serene beauty of the Thames riverbank by day and the city's vibrant theatrical spirit by night. This day weaves a gentle rhythm of riverside strolls, architecturally stunning sights, and intimate cultural performances. August’s mild evenings invite you to experience London’s illuminated bridges and enjoy spirited West End shows, blending quiet reflection with the city’s urbane pulse to craft unforgettable memories for two.

Begin your final day with a visit to , whose striking neo-Gothic towers pierce the city skyline with historic elegance. Ascend to the high-level walkways to gaze out across the serpentine Thames, marvelling at reflections of London’s contrasting architecture — historic warehouses mingle with glass skyscrapers — all brilliantly illuminated by bright August daylight filtering through sometimes gentle clouds. Inside the Exhibition, explore the Victorian engine rooms and learn about the engineering genius that keeps this iconic bridge both functional and visually stunning. A perfect blend of history, technology, and beauty, the experience sets a reflective tone to your day.

From , enjoy a leisurely stroll westward along the Southbank walkway, where the rhythms of city life gently pulse with street performances, riverside cafés, and glimpses of ships and rowers tracing the river’s course. August’s warm weather and long daylight extend golden hours perfect for just drifting beside the water, watching the world go by while pausing to chat with local artists or grab a handcrafted ice cream. The walk offers changing vistas of London’s landmarks including the Globe Theatre and the shimmering glass façade of the Shard in the distance, capturing London’s unique blend of history and modernity on the river.

Pause your riverside reverie at the , a cultural beacon housed in a repurposed power station offering an inspiring encounter with cutting-edge contemporary art. Inside, the cavernous Turbine Hall captivates as much as the curated exhibitions that showcase boundary-pushing works by global artists. August often brings special seasonal exhibits, so you may witness multimedia installations or interactive pieces that provoke thought and conversation. This museum visit encourages a meditative moment that’s both intellectually stimulating and visually enthralling, perfect for two immersed in London’s artistic life.

As dusk falls, prepare for a magical evening in London’s West End, where theatres come alive with dazzling lights, music, and storytelling. Choose from long-running musicals or bold new productions to share an evening of entertainment that is intimate and spectacular all at once. The buzz of theatregoers, the artful performances, and the historic venues infuse a sense of shared wonder and exhilaration. Post-show, linger in the surrounding vibrant streets with their lively bars and quaint cafés, reflecting on your four unforgettable days in London while planning your next visit to this endlessly inspiring city.
